Jaat's Box Office Run: A Rollercoaster Ride

Sunny Deol's Jaat exploded onto the scene on April 10th, 2025. The action thriller had a strong opening, leaving everyone wondering: could this be Sunny Deol's big comeback? Its performance in the first week was promising, but the real test? Day 5 and beyond. Let's dive in.

The Day 5 Dip (and Why It Matters)

So, Day 5 (Monday, April 14th) rolled around, and things took a bit of a downturn. Early estimates put Jaat's earnings around ₹7-8 crores – a pretty significant drop from Sunday's numbers. We're talking about a 43-50% decrease! Ouch. You know how sometimes things just spiral? That's kinda what it felt like watching the numbers. Despite the dip, the film still managed a respectable 5-day India net collection of ₹47.62-48.62 crores. Not bad, but certainly not the fireworks we initially expected.

The audience response was pretty scattered, too. Occupancy rates varied wildly across different cities. Chennai was practically buzzing with a 94.25% occupancy, while Mumbai was considerably quieter at 13.75%. It's fascinating to see how regional tastes and hype can sway the box office.

The Competition: A Tough Crowd

Jaat wasn't alone in the ring. It was up against some serious competition, most notably Good Bad Ugly, a Tamil action comedy that completely dominated the opening week, raking in over ₹100 crores in India net. Honestly, who saw that coming? But here's where Jaat held its ground: while it didn't match Good Bad Ugly's explosive start, its decline wasn't as steep as another recent release, Sikandar, which plummeted after its initial success. This hints at a potentially longer lifespan for Jaat in theaters.

Sunny Deol's Triumph (So Far)

Even with the Day 5 slowdown, Jaat's performance is huge for Sunny Deol. In just five days, it zoomed past seven of his previous films to become his fourth highest-grossing movie! That's a testament to the film’s appeal and a massive boost to his box office standing. It's a definite win for him.
